Login
Start Free Trial Are you a business?? Click Here
Anonymous
Sadly recently having problems with communicating with company. Also feel after being with them for years not considerated a good customer. Def feel as if I should try and find another supplier
1 year ago
Read Scottish Power Reviews
Scottish Power has a 1.1 average rating from 1,124 reviews